High Precision Flat Mirrors

Optical Surfaces Ltd. is a leading manufacturer of large, high precision flat mirrors used in a wide variety of applications including beam steering, beam folding, interferometry and as optical components within imaging systems.

Working in a thermally stable production environment – the experienced optical engineers at Optical Surfaces Ltd. can regularly achieve surface accuracies of better than ʎ/20 peak to valley on flats up to 750 mm in diameter. Achieving high surface accuracy, top surface quality (10/5) and typical microroughness of less than 1.0 nm RMS on flat mirror substrates decreases the amount of light lost through dispersion.

Flat Mirrors from Optical Surfaces Ltd are often manufactured in highly stable optical materials such as Zerodur® and ClearCeram®-Z. The most common coating on flat mirrors is aluminium which offers good reflectivity in the UV, visible and mid-infrared spectral wavebands. Protected silver coatings provide the highest reflectivity for flat mirrors operating in the visible and protected gold is the most efficient coating for infrared applications. For high power laser applications, a multilayer dielectric coating can be applied directly to the substrate surface.

All optical flats and flat mirrors from Optical Surfaces Ltd. come with full quality testing assurance. Optics up to 600 mm diameter are provided with a Fizeau interferometric test report, larger flats are quality assured using the Ritchey-Common test procedure.
